ReseaChem offers a broad range of services in synthesis of single labeled or unlabeled compounds for R&D purposes to explorative synthesis of compounds or libraries, isolation of natural products or degradation products as well as structure elucidation of unknown products. Unique is the offered 24-hour-NMR-service and the 24-hour-MS-service. Especially a unique expertise in the synthesis, analysis and isolation of modified DNA/RNA building block is offered.

ez Control

The ez-Control is an easy to use system for bioreactors and fermentors. The system accurately controls pH, Temperature, Dissolved Oxygen, Foam/Level and Agitation. The color touch screen interface guides the user through the operation. The adaptive control features allow the user to focus on the process while the controller keeps tight control on the important process parameters.

Although the system has a very small footprint, the capabilities are beyond any other laboratory process control system.

What makes this controller unique are its ease of use, its small footprint, its flexibility and its accurate control.

The system can control:
- autoclavable bioreactors,
- steam in place bioreactors,
- Appliflex single use bioreactors
- Millipore CellReady single use bioreactors
- HyClone SUB bioreactors

Some of the ez-Control highlights are:
- Simple operation through the color touch screen guides the operator and prevents errors
- Adaptive PID control guarantees the most accurate control of your process parameters
- OPC compliance eases integration in a computer network for process data handling
- User definable control loop configuration offers unique flexibility in adding other sensors to your process
- Define, store, copy and reload process configurations to reduce your experiment setup time
- Local data storage and display up to 72 hours offers complete process overview on the lab bench
- Synoptic, trending and bargraph displays supply all relevant process information in a glance
- Multiple user s levels for secure access to the process
- Can be used with classic and with fluorofor sensors (pH and oxygen) to match changing process demands
- Can integrate viable biomass sensor for measurement and control to maximize process information
- Due to the GAMP compliant development documentation the system can be used in validated processes

Mini Bioreactors: Real Small, Real bioreactors

Introduction
The MiniBio range of bioreactors (250 ml, 500 ml and 1000 ml total volume) is a true scale down of the laboratory scale bioreactors in the 1 to 15 liter range. The MiniBio systems have the same flexibility as the laboratory scale bioreactors. This means that the MiniBio systems can be customized to fit the demands of any process. The small volume reduces medium costs and reduces the use expensive bench space.

Functions of mini bioreactors:
Generate more data in less time
Easy setup and operation
Cultivate using less medium
Cultivate using les bench space
Generate scalable results
Mimic lab scale bioreactors
Easy data handling

my-Control
my-Control is a dedicated control system for the small scale bioreactors. One control system can control:
250 ml up to 1000 ml MiniBio bioreactors
1l up to 3 liter Autoclavable bioreactors
3 liter Cellready single use bioreactors

Features of the my-Control:
PID and autotuning adaptive control
Operation via webbrowser , iPod, iPhone or iPad
1 up to 32 parallel my-Controllers per network
Integrated amplifiers for agitation, pH, DO, Temperature, Level and foam
Actuators for up to 6 variable speed pumps or micro valve additions, up to 4 Mass Flow Controllers, Heating and Cooling (via Peltier or heating blanket),condenser cooling (Peltier or cooling water)
Spare I/O: 8 x digital output, 4 x analog in (0 – 10 V), 4 x analog out (0/4 – 20 mA)
USB connection for Biomass or Fluorophor pH and DO

MiniBio reactor specifications:
250 ml total volume, 50 ml .. 200 ml working volume
500 ml total volume, 100 ml .. 400 ml working volume
1000 ml total volume, 200 ml .. 800 ml working volume

  • Bioreactor design

    Designing a bioreactor
    system involves mechanical,
    electrical and bioprocess engineering.
    Since a standard bioreactor can be
    used in a variety of applications, the design
    process should be organized such that these
    systems can be applied under the strictest
    regulations. These design rules are described
    in the cGMP and GAMP guidelines as
    well as the ASME BPE guidelines for design
    of bioprocess equipment.
    Typical applications of bioreactors can be
    found in the production of pharmaceuticals,
    food production, waste treatment, bio based
    materials (such as poly-lactic acid) and biofuels.

  • MiniBio

    Features of the new MiniBio reactor of Applikon
    -Mechanically coupled agitator that allows mixing up to 2000 rpm even in viscous media or high density cultures.
    - Minimum working volume of 50 ml in our 250 ml system (with mixing and measurement and control of pH, Temp, DO, foam and level.
    - Autotuning adaptive PID control for accurate control even when the process conditions change
    - Up to 6 variable speed pumps per system
    - Microdosing with flow rates down to 1.8 ml/hour continuously.
    - Control any number from 1 to 16 or even 32 bioreactors from 1 pc.
    - Very limited bench space 5 systems on 100x60 cm
    - All electric connections (no water connections required)
    - Additional inputs and outputs for external sensors and pumps
    - Complete configurational freedom. Customer can connected any actuator to any sensor input and create a new control loop.
    - Software runs within each controller so if you loose connection with the pc the process is not stopped.
    - Individual coloring of the control units.
